• Jeremiah 39:10

    But Nebuzaradan the captain of the guard left of the poor of the people, which had nothing, in the land of Judah, and gave them vineyards and fields at the same time.

  • Jeremiah 39:11

    Now Nebuchadrezzar king of Babylon gave charge concerning Jeremiah toc Nebuzaradan the captain of the guard, saying,

  • Jeremiah 39:12

    Take him, and look well to him, and do him no harm; but do unto him even as he shall say unto thee.

  • Jeremiah 39:13

    So Nebuzaradan the captain of the guard sent, and Nebushasban, Rabsaris, and Nergalsharezer, Rabmag, and all the king of Babylon's princes;

  • Jeremiah 39:14

    Even they sent, and took Jeremiah out of the court of the prison, and committed him unto Gedaliah the son of Ahikam the son of Shaphan, that he should carry him home: so he dwelt among the people.
